    Dream airlines for me but I don't speak Japanese. Do ANA or JAL hire non-Japanese speakers, and through which bases?

  2. #2

    Both hire some foreign-national crew for specific bases and routes, historically through overseas bases (e.g. Bangkok, Singapore, London for certain fleets) and international recruitment rounds, with Japanese not always required for those. For the main Tokyo base, Japanese is expected. Watch the international careers pages; the postings are rare and specific about language.
